We use Aptly to streamline the rental process and make moving in faster and easier. Tied in with TransUnion
(a credit reporting agency that safely houses data for approximately 500 million people worldwide), Aptly also
gives you the ability to apply for a lease while protecting your personal information. Aptly (AKA TransUnion) will
generate your reports without disclosing your personal identification and account numbers, and with a much
quicker turnout time. Plus, when you use Aptly your credit score will not be impacted. Unlike when a lender or
landlord retrieves your information, Aptly lets you be the one to initiate the request for your own file to be sent
and is seen as a ‘soft hit’ on your credit history.

Move-In Inspections

Move-in inspections are done at the rental property prior to your move to verify the condition of the property.
We will be looking at the general condition of the home, both inside and outside. We take notes of the property
before occupancy.

We will also conduct a move-out inspection after you have vacated the property. If the property is in good
condition and has been well kept without any problem areas (that weren’t noted in the move-in inspection), you
will receive a full refund of your deposit. We do our best to coach you on how to get a full refund.

Utilities In your Rental Property

It is your responsibility to notify utility companies upon your move-in date. Key Partners Property Management
does not take responsibility for transferring the utilities into your name.
Upon move-out, do not disconnect the utilities, simply take them out of your name.

Renter’s Insurance

The renter is responsible for insurance to cover the contents of the home. This is available through your
insurance agent. Owners require “pet insurance” also. For more information on renter’s insurance, see our
Renter’s FAQs.

Renters Maintenance Responsibilities

It is the renter’s responsibility to mow and maintain the lawn unless otherwise stated in your lease agreement.
You will also be responsible for changing the furnace filters every three months, changing light bulbs, smoke
detector batteries and general day to day maintenance.
